How to fill out recommended tier 2 tmdl:

01
Start by gathering all necessary data and information related to the specific water body or pollutant that the tier 2 Total Maximum Daily Load (TMDL) is being developed for. This may include water quality data, pollutant source information, and other relevant data.
02
Review the recommended tier 2 TMDL guidelines provided by the relevant regulatory agency or organization. These guidelines will outline the specific requirements and steps to follow in order to complete the tier 2 TMDL.
03
Identify the specific goals and objectives of the recommended tier 2 TMDL. This involves understanding the desired water quality targets or standards to be achieved, as well as any specific pollutant reduction goals.
04
Analyze the available data to determine the existing pollutant loadings and identify the major sources of pollution. This step will help in identifying the necessary pollutant reduction targets and the best management practices to implement.
05
Assess the various management options and Best Management Practices (BMPs) that can be implemented to achieve the desired pollutant reductions. This may involve evaluating the effectiveness and feasibility of different pollution control measures.
06
Develop a plan of action for implementing the recommended tier 2 TMDL. This may involve outlining the specific BMPs to be implemented, identifying responsible parties, and establishing a timeline for implementation.
07
Consider the financial and technical feasibility of implementing the recommended tier 2 TMDL. This may involve identifying potential funding sources, considering any necessary infrastructure improvements, and assessing the capacity of stakeholders to implement the plan.
08
Consult with relevant stakeholders, including local communities, industries, and environmental organizations, to gather input and ensure broad support for the recommended tier 2 TMDL.
09
Prepare the final recommended tier 2 TMDL report, including all relevant data, analyses, and recommendations. This report should be presented in a clear and concise manner, with supporting documents and references.
10
Submit the recommended tier 2 TMDL report to the appropriate regulatory agency or organization for review and approval.

Who needs recommended tier 2 tmdl:

01
Environmental regulatory agencies often require the development of recommended tier 2 TMDLs for water bodies that do not meet water quality standards or have impaired conditions. These agencies need the recommended tier 2 TMDL to assess the sources and impacts of pollutants, and to develop strategies for improving water quality.
02
Scientists and researchers studying water quality and pollution also need recommended tier 2 TMDLs to understand the current state of water bodies and to develop effective pollution control measures.
03
Water resource managers and planners utilize recommended tier 2 TMDLs to guide their decision-making processes and implement management practices to improve the water quality of impaired water bodies.
04
Industries, agriculture, and other stakeholders may need recommended tier 2 TMDLs to understand their contribution to water pollution and to develop appropriate pollution reduction strategies.
05
Local communities and environmental organizations can utilize recommended tier 2 TMDLs to advocate for the protection and improvement of local water bodies, as well as to participate in the decision-making processes related to water quality management.
